Includes black and white photographs and 1 color postcard of the J. Hooker Hamersley boat, given to SCI in 1915. In addition to transporting crews to and from ships, the boat was used as a training vessel during World War I.

Includes black and white photographs and drawings of views and activities taking place at Jeanette Park. Jeanette Park was located next to 25 South Street, SCI's headquarters from 1913-1967.
